The Great Volga megaproject, aimed at developing the tourism sector in 13 regions of Russia located on the banks of the great river, also includes the tourism potential of the Ivanovo region, the press service of the regional administration reported on April 19.
The authors of the federal project “Great Volga” visited the region to study its tourism possibilities in more detail. In particular, they examined the railway station building and some other architectural objects built in the constructivist style. They also visited historic textile factory buildings and museums.
After Ivanovo, a group of experts traveled to the cities of Kineshma and Yuryevets. At the end of the business visit, a meeting was held with representatives of the regional tourism directorate, with representatives of the tourism business community also present. The meeting discussed the development of new tourist routes and the development of existing ones.
